Ingredients:
1 cup Gram Flour (Besan)
½ pound of Plain Yogurt
1 tsp. Red Chilli Powder (Pisi Lal Mirch)
Salt (to taste)
3 Curry Leaves (Karhi Pattay)
3 tbsp. Cooking Oil
1 tsp. Coriander Seeds (Saabut Dhania)
¼ tsp. Tamarind Paste (Imli)
1 tbsp. Green Chillies
1 tbsp. Fresh Cilantro (Hara Dhania)
1 tsp. Cumin Seeds (Saabut Sufaid Zeera)
1 medium Onion
3 cloves of Garlic (Lehsan)
1 (1 inch piece) Ginger (Adrak)
Ingredients for Dumplings/Pakoras
1 cup Gram Flour (Besan)
1 tsp. Red Chilli Powder (Pisi Lal Mirch)
1 tsp. Salt
1 tbsp. Fresh Cilantro (Hara Dhania)
1 tbsp. Mint Leaves (Podina)
¼ tsp. Baking Powder
1 small Onion
1 tbsp. Green Chillies
1 tsp. Cumin Seeds (Saabut Sufaid Zeera)
Cooking Oil (for frying dumplings)
Method:
Thinly slice the onion.
Heat oil in a pot and add the sliced onions to it.
Make a paste of the Garlic,Ginger and Green Chillis and add this to the onions.
Lightly grind Cumin and Coriander seeds and mix in onions and garlic mixture and cook on medium heat.
Add the Red Chillies, Salt, Curry leaves, and Tamarind Paste and fry for another 5-10 minutes.
Meanwhile, Mix 1 cup of Gram Flour in the plain yogurt and make into a smooth paste by adding small amouts of water at a time.
Add this yogurt mixture in onions and mix and cook by constantly mixing.
Keep mixing until it starts to come to a boil.
Then turn heat level low and leave it to cook slowly until it thickens.
Chop onions and mix it with the gram flour and water.
Mix into a smooth paste.
Lightly ground coriander and cumin seeds with green chillies and them mix this into the gram flour mixture.
Add all ingredients in the paste and set aside for half an hour.
Fry Dumplings in a deep frying pan until golden brown and take them out and put them on a paper towel to absorb any access oil.
When karhi becomes thick, add 1 cup of boiling water and let it cook until it starts to boil, when it comes to a boil add dumplings in karhi and then cook on low heat for another 10 minutes.
Garnish with coriander leaves.
